The phrase "black is beautiful" referred to a broad embrace of black culture and identity. It called for an appreciation of the black past as a worthy legacy, and it inspired cultural pride in contemporary black achievements. In its philosophy, "Black is beautiful" focused also on emotional and psychological well-being.

Acrylic nails were created in the US in 1950 and became popular with Hollywood stars. However, the first black woman to be on the cover of Vogue, African-American model Donyale Luna most notably wore them on the cover of Twen Magazine in 1966. Acrylic nails then appeared on the salon scene in the 1970s and became associated with black 70s Disco.

AP's style is now to capitalize Black in a racial, ethnic or cultural sense, conveying an essential and shared sense of history, identity and community among people who identify as Black, includ ing those in the African diaspora and within Africa.The lowercase black is a color, not a person. AP style will continue to lowercase the term white in racial, ethnic and cultural senses.

5. Bucket Hats . The history of the bucket hat began with its original name, the fishing hat from the 1900's, when Irish farmers and fishmermen used them as protection from the rain.Fast forward to the 1960's the hat was adapted as a ladies accessory, in a stiffer version and more elegant style.However, the bucket hat was first introduced to street style in the 1980's by the hip hop.

Celebrity Inspiration: 90s icons like Salt n Pepa, Will Smith, and Queen Latifah wore Afrocentric clothing. This included Kufi hats, head wraps, wax prints, and African colors such as red, gold, green and black. This brought African culture to Hollywood and our TV screens.
